Output e6cb34a5f5d069cb176b0872068c7db9e8ee70124a09d396b58fee14916fc959:6

value
341940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56fb26e7ff0cdb5d37283861462ac4bc1b73c9cf OP_EQUAL
address
39cvuPNQb6JNCFaXnCVPCGSGy6bsuHUg5f
transaction
e6cb34a5f5d069cb176b0872068c7db9e8ee70124a09d396b58fee14916fc959
spent
true